///
/// \file DetLayer.cxx
/// \author David Dobrigkeit Chinellato
/// \since 11/03/2021
/// \brief Basic struct to hold information regarding a detector layer to be used in fast simulation
///
#include <vector>
#include <string>
#include "DetLayer.h"
namespace o2::fastsim
{
// Parametric constructor
DetLayer::DetLayer(const TString& name_,
float r_,
float z_,
float x0_,
float xrho_,
float resRPhi_,
float resZ_,
float eff_,
int type_)
: name(name_),
r(r_),
z(z_),
x0(x0_),
xrho(xrho_),
resRPhi(resRPhi_),
resZ(resZ_),
eff(eff_),
type(type_)
{
}
DetLayer::DetLayer(const DetLayer& other)
: name(other.name), r(other.r), z(other.z), x0(other.x0), xrho(other.xrho), resRPhi(other.resRPhi), resZ(other.resZ), eff(other.eff), type(other.type)
{
}
std::string DetLayer::toString() const
{
std::string out = "";
out.append("DetLayer: ");
out.append(name.Data());
out.append(" | r: ");
out.append(std::to_string(r));
out.append(" cm | z: ");
out.append(std::to_string(z));
out.append(" cm | x0: ");
out.append(std::to_string(x0));
out.append(" cm | xrho: ");
out.append(std::to_string(xrho));
out.append(" g/cm^3 | resRPhi: ");
out.append(std::to_string(resRPhi));
out.append(" cm | resZ: ");
out.append(std::to_string(resZ));
out.append(" cm | eff: ");
out.append(std::to_string(eff));
out.append(" | type: ");
switch (type) {
case layerInert:
out.append("Inert");
break;
case layerSilicon:
out.append("Silicon");
break;
case layerGas:
out.append("Gas/TPC");
break;
default:
out.append("Unknown");
break;
}
return out;
}
} // namespace o2::fastsim
